Enigma2 auf dem PC

  • Zitat

    Originally posted by AliAbdul1978
    You have to write your own nim_sockets file. This one is mine:

    Code
    aliabdul@aliabdul-desktop:/usr/local/share/enigma2$ cat ./nim_sockets
    NIM Socket 0:
             Type: DVB-S2
             Name: Terratec Cinergy S2 PCI
             Has_Outputs: no
    aliabdul@aliabdul-desktop:/usr/local/share/enigma2$


    Please don't ask me how the dreamboxes are getting the tuners in this file but I couldn't find it in the complete sources. Maybe due some drivers... no idea!?


    That was indeed the fix! I also had to download tuxtxt.ttf but now it starts. :smiling_face:


    I just did a little test. DVB-T scanning goes fine (Gigabyte GT-U7000-RH). And I can tune it and I see values. But no picture yet (I guess it still needs some patching). DVB-S(2) scanning doesn't work on my Hauppauge WinTV-HVR4000. But I think this is because of a not working DISEQC configuration.


    Time do some hacking, I think :winking_face:


    -- edit --


    By not enabling DISEQC, I do now have lock on my primary LNB (Astra 19.2e). I can now receive EPG.


    Regards,


    Niels Wagenaar

    Einmal editiert, zuletzt von nwagenaar ()

  • Well, I think this is the missing MPEG-Decoder. You have other hardware in your PC and the Hardware-MPEG-Decoder of the Dreambox is missing in your PC. We must integrate somehow a Software-MPEG-Decoder. There are a lot of open-source ones. Maybe libavcodec or something else.

    MfG Ali

    DM8000 | DM8000 | DM500HD | DM500HD | DM7020S


    Bash
    #!/bin/sh
    while [ 1 ]
    do
    	echo "i love my dreams!!!"
    	sleep 1
    done
  • Yep. If I read the code correctly, Audio and Video are being decoded by the adapter. So we need a softdevice output for audio and video.


    Oh boy, this is going to get messy. :winking_face:


    Regards,


    Niels Wagenaar

  • Zitat

    Originally posted by AliAbdul1978
    Well, I think this is the missing MPEG-Decoder. You have other hardware in your PC and the Hardware-MPEG-Decoder of the Dreambox is missing in your PC. We must integrate somehow a Software-MPEG-Decoder. There are a lot of open-source ones. Maybe libavcodec or something else.


    MayBe a FullFeatured DVB-S (including MPEG decoder) card will do the trick.

  • PYTHONPATH: /usr/local/lib/enigma2/python
    + (1) Background File Eraser
    + (8) graphics acceleration manager
    + (9) gSDLDC
    + (9) gLCDDC
    couldn't open LCD - load lcd.o!
    + (9) Font Render Class
    [FONT] initializing lib...
    [FONT] loading fonts...
    [FONT] Intializing font cache, using max. 4MB...
    + (10) gRC
    RC thread created successfully
    + (15) eWindowStyleManager
    + (20) DVB-CI UI
    + (20) misc options
    + (20) UHF Modulator
    couldnt open /dev/rfmod0!!!!
    + (20) AVSwitch Driver
    couldnt open /dev/dbox/fp0 to monitor vcr scart slow blanking changed!
    + (20) RC Input layer
    + (21) Console RC Driver
    failed to open /dev/vc/0
    + (21) input device driver
    Input device "Macintosh mouse button emulation" is not a keyboard.
    Input device "AT Translated Set 2 keyboard" is a keyboard.
    Input device "Power Button (FF)" is not a keyboard.
    Input device "Power Button (CM)" is not a keyboard.
    Input device "PC Speaker" is not a keyboard.
    Input device "ImPS/2 Generic Wheel Mouse" is not a keyboard.
    Input device "cx88 IR (Hauppauge WinTV-HVR400" is not a keyboard.
    Found 7 input devices!
    + (30) eActionMap
    + (35) CI Slots
    scanning for common interfaces..
    cannot open /proc/stb/tsmux/input0
    cannot open /proc/stb/tsmux/input1
    done, found 0 common interface slots
    + (40) eServiceCenter
    settings instance.
    + (41) eServiceFactoryFS
    + (41) eServiceFactoryDVB
    reached rl 70
    ---- opening lame channel db
    reading services (version 4)
    loaded 4654 services
    scanning for frontends..
    opening frontend 0
    detected satellite frontend
    close frontend 0
    found 1 adapter, 1 frontends(1 sim) and 1 demux
    Use valid Linux Time :smiling_face: (RTC?)
    [EPGC] Initialized EPGCache
    [EPGC] time updated.. start EPG Mainloop
    before: 1
    after: 1
    Loading spinners...
    found 4 spinner!


    executing main
    setIoPrio best-effort level 3 ok
    FLUSH
    couldn't open fp
    enumerating block devices...
    found block device 'ram0': ok, removable=False, cdrom=False, partitions=[], device=ram0
    found block device 'ram1': ok, removable=False, cdrom=False, partitions=[], device=ram1
    found block device 'ram2': ok, removable=False, cdrom=False, partitions=[], device=ram2
    found block device 'ram3': ok, removable=False, cdrom=False, partitions=[], device=ram3
    found block device 'ram4': ok, removable=False, cdrom=False, partitions=[], device=ram4
    found block device 'ram5': ok, removable=False, cdrom=False, partitions=[], device=ram5
    found block device 'ram6': ok, removable=False, cdrom=False, partitions=[], device=ram6
    found block device 'ram7': ok, removable=False, cdrom=False, partitions=[], device=ram7
    found block device 'ram8': ok, removable=False, cdrom=False, partitions=[], device=ram8
    found block device 'ram9': ok, removable=False, cdrom=False, partitions=[], device=ram9
    found block device 'ram10': ok, removable=False, cdrom=False, partitions=[], device=ram10
    found block device 'ram11': ok, removable=False, cdrom=False, partitions=[], device=ram11
    found block device 'ram12': ok, removable=False, cdrom=False, partitions=[], device=ram12
    found block device 'ram13': ok, removable=False, cdrom=False, partitions=[], device=ram13
    found block device 'ram14': ok, removable=False, cdrom=False, partitions=[], device=ram14
    found block device 'ram15': ok, removable=False, cdrom=False, partitions=[], device=ram15
    found block device 'fd0': ok, removable=True, cdrom=False, partitions=[], device=fd0
    found block device 'sda': ok, removable=False, cdrom=False, partitions=['sda1', 'sda2', 'sda3', 'sda4', 'sda5'], device=sda
    found block device 'sr0': ok, removable=True, cdrom=True, partitions=[], device=sr0
    Reading satellites.xml
    sec config cleared
    setSlotInfo for dvb frontend 0 to slotid 0, descr (Kathrein ufs910) cx24116 (internal), need rotorworkaround No, enabled No, DVB-S2 Yes
    slot: 0 configmode: nothing
    sec config completed
    loading bouquet... /usr/etc/enigma2/bouquets.tv
    loading bouquet... /usr/etc/enigma2/userbouquet.favourites.tv
    0 entries in Bouquet userbouquet.favourites.tv
    1 entries in Bouquet bouquets.tv
    loading bouquet... /usr/etc/enigma2/bouquets.radio
    loading bouquet... /usr/etc/enigma2/userbouquet.favourites.radio
    0 entries in Bouquet userbouquet.favourites.radio
    1 entries in Bouquet bouquets.radio
    twisted not available
    add dreampackage scanner plugin
    added
    [FONT] adding font /usr/local/share/fonts/nmsbd.ttf...OK (Regular)
    [FONT] adding font /usr/local/share/fonts/lcd.ttf...OK (LCD)
    [FONT] adding font /usr/local/share/fonts/ae_AlMateen.ttf...OK (Replacement)
    [FONT] adding font /usr/local/share/fonts/tuxtxt.ttf...OK (Console)
    cannot open /proc/stb/avs/0/colorformat
    cannot open /proc/stb/video/aspect
    cannot open /proc/stb/denc/0/wss
    cannot open /proc/stb/avs/0/sb
    cannot open /proc/stb/denc/0/wss
    cannot open /proc/stb/avs/0/input
    cannot open /proc/stb/denc/0/wss
    cannot open /proc/stb/avs/0/sb
    cannot open /proc/stb/avs/0/colorformat
    cannot open /proc/stb/avs/0/input_choices
    couldn't open /proc/stb/misc/12V_output
    192.168
    169.254
    0.0.0.0
    192.168
    nameservers: [[192, 168, 2, 1]]
    read interfaces: {'lo': {'dhcp': False}}
    self.ifaces after loading: {'tun0': {'preup': False, 'ip': [192, 168, 99, 130], 'up': True, 'netmask': [255, 255, 255, 252], 'dhcp': False, 'postdown': False}, 'wlan0': {'preup': False, 'ip': [192, 168, 2, 4], 'up': True, 'netmask': [255, 255, 255, 0], 'dhcp': False, 'bcast': [192, 168, 2, 255], 'gateway': [192, 168, 2, 1], 'postdown': False}, 'eth0': {'preup': False, 'ip': [192, 168, 1, 2], 'up': True, 'netmask': [255, 255, 255, 0], 'dhcp': True, 'gateway': [192, 168, 1, 1], 'postdown': False}}
    Activating language Turkish
    language set to tr_TR
    Plugin SystemPlugins/Hotplug failed to load: No module named twisted.internet.protocol
    Traceback (most recent call last):
    File "/usr/local/lib/enigma2/python/Components/PluginComponent.py", line 51, in readPluginList
    plugin = my_import('.'.join(["Plugins", c, pluginname, "plugin"]))
    File "/usr/local/lib/enigma2/python/Tools/Import.py", line 2, in my_import
    mod = __import__(name)
    File "/usr/local/lib/enigma2/python/Plugins/SystemPlugins/Hotplug/plugin.py", line 2, in <module>
    from twisted.internet.protocol import Protocol, Factory
    ImportError: No module named twisted.internet.protocol
    skipping plugin.
    getFPVersion failed!
    sh: fpupgrade: command not found
    couldn't read available videomodes.
    getModeList for port YPbPr
    getModeList for port Scart
    getModeList for port DVI-PC
    getModeList for port DVI
    reading preferred modes failed, using all modes
    current port not available, not setting videomode
    current port not available, not setting videomode
    current port not available, not setting videomode
    current port not available, not setting videomode
    Plugin SystemPlugins/Videomode failed to load: [Errno 2] No such file or directory: '/proc/stb/avs/0/fb'
    Traceback (most recent call last):
    File "/usr/local/lib/enigma2/python/Components/PluginComponent.py", line 51, in readPluginList
    plugin = my_import('.'.join(["Plugins", c, pluginname, "plugin"]))
    File "/usr/local/lib/enigma2/python/Tools/Import.py", line 2, in my_import
    mod = __import__(name)
    File "/usr/local/lib/enigma2/python/Plugins/SystemPlugins/Videomode/plugin.py", line 7, in <module>
    from VideoHardware import video_hw
    File "/usr/local/lib/enigma2/python/Plugins/SystemPlugins/Videomode/VideoHardware.py", line 328, in <module>
    video_hw = VideoHardware()
    File "/usr/local/lib/enigma2/python/Plugins/SystemPlugins/Videomode/VideoHardware.py", line 94, in __init__
    config.av.colorformat.addNotifier(self.updateFastblank)
    File "/usr/local/lib/enigma2/python/Components/config.py", line 96, in addNotifier
    notifier(self)
    File "/usr/local/lib/enigma2/python/Plugins/SystemPlugins/Videomode/VideoHardware.py", line 325, in updateFastblank
    open("/proc/stb/avs/0/fb", "w").write(fb)
    IOError: [Errno 2] No such file or directory: '/proc/stb/avs/0/fb'
    skipping plugin.
    Plugin Extensions/TuxboxPlugins failed to load: No module named pluginrunner
    Traceback (most recent call last):
    File "/usr/local/lib/enigma2/python/Components/PluginComponent.py", line 51, in readPluginList
    plugin = my_import('.'.join(["Plugins", c, pluginname, "plugin"]))
    File "/usr/local/lib/enigma2/python/Tools/Import.py", line 2, in my_import
    mod = __import__(name)
    File "/usr/local/lib/enigma2/python/Plugins/Extensions/TuxboxPlugins/plugin.py", line 5, in <module>
    from pluginrunner import PluginRunner
    ImportError: No module named pluginrunner
    skipping plugin.
    [eSocketMMIHandler] created successfully
    It's now Wed Oct 22 17:38:19 2008
    [timer.py] next activation: 1224697199 (in 99061 ms)
    wasTimerWakeup failed!
    It's now Wed Oct 22 17:38:19 2008
    [timer.py] next activation: 1224697199 (in 99045 ms)
    not showing fine-tuning wizard, config variable doesn't exist
    showtestcard is false
    Looking for embedded skin
    setValue 100
    cannot open /proc/stb/audio/j1_mute(No such file or directory)
    Setvolume: 100 100 (raw)
    Setvolume: 0 0 (-1db)
    cannot open /proc/stb/avs/0/volume(No such file or directory)
    Setvolume: 100 100 (raw)
    Setvolume: 0 0 (-1db)
    cannot open /proc/stb/avs/0/volume(No such file or directory)
    allocating new converter!
    allocating new converter!
    allocating new converter!
    allocating new converter!
    allocating new converter!
    allocating new converter!
    allocating new converter!
    allocating new converter!
    allocating new converter!
    allocating new converter!
    no teletext plugin found!
    RemovePopup, id = ZapError
    allocating new converter!
    but not creat nim_sockets please help
    me card wintv nova dvb-s/s2 hd



  • http://www.youtube.com/watch?v=H_24aGKfZTo
    lirc setup and lirc.conf edit enigma2 runing and remotecontrol enigma
    me remote wintv nova dvb-s/s2 hd card
    but no screen..


    me decoder card reelboxhd pci and sigmadesing x-card please help..



    lütfen yard1m edin...

    Einmal editiert, zuletzt von kanber_kav ()

  • friend...


    setup lirc (synaptic) or source code make and
    you remote control file /etc/lirc.conf file in copy


    and remote control start..


    runing enigma2 and remote enigma2


    but no picture channel because picture plugins make not found.


    msn:kanber_kav@hotmail.com

    Einmal editiert, zuletzt von kanber_kav ()

  • You didn't configure a lircrc file?


    How should this work? And what is "remote enigma2"?


    I have already lircd running with an own made lirc.conf fpr the DMM-RC (with lircrecord).


    You don't have a picture because of a missing MPEG-Decoder.

    MfG Ali

    DM8000 | DM8000 | DM500HD | DM500HD | DM7020S


    Bash
    #!/bin/sh
    while [ 1 ]
    do
    	echo "i love my dreams!!!"
    	sleep 1
    done
  • friend; if your runing lirc. remote enigma2 not stretch dreambox file.


    my remote wintv nova dvb-s/s2 card and
    encoder card Reelbox Extension hd pci and reelmagic x-card but extension hd runing vdr system but not runing enigma2.


    me necessary plugins decoder card runinng..


    help me.

  • Hi,


    I honestly tried to reproduce your results, but failed. Enigma2 always crashes with SIGSEGV.


    Maybe one of you wants to share his source tree and libraries with me, e. g. upload to rapdishare.


    Thanks

  • Very cool, it didn't crash anymore.
    Thank you


    lirc isn't working. Can you paste your lircd.conf here?
    Maybe the naming of the buttons is important.


    Thanks again


    Roland